Bailey's Brake Service,a bit of an eyesore at a main intersection near the faltering downtown area of Mesa,Arizona,was a family-founded,owned and operated business that had been open in its existing location since 1970.Lenhardt's True Value Hardware store was also a longstanding Mesa business with a location south and east of Bailey's and a desire for a better location as well as a professed desire to revitalize Mesa's downtown area.The Lenhardts had purchased the property abutting Bailey's but felt that the street-facing Bailey's property was necessary for its location,location,location.
The city fathers and mothers were in favor of condemnation of the Bailey use,a taking by eminent domain,followed by a "reissuing" of the once Bailey property to Lenhardt's for its construction of a new and much less eyesoreish retail establishment on the site:
Randy Bailey challenged the taking of his business as unconstitutional.Discuss the issues in his case and challenge to the city's taking by eminent domain.


Definitions:

Free Trade

The absence of artificial (government) barriers to trade among individuals and firms in different nations.

Economic Inefficiency

A situation where resources are not allocated optimally, leading to waste or loss in the potential value of output.

Hollow Corporation

A business model where a company outsources most of its production processes, keeping only core functions such as design, marketing, and branding in-house.

Imports Foreign Goods

The act of bringing goods and services from foreign countries into one's own country for sale.
